Maly 7-8/2003 AH-64 Apache

Hi everyone,

After a ship and two vehicles, it's the air time. The Apache arrived a little over a week ago and jumped right away to the top of the pile :D
The kit looks like as computer generated and nicely colored, except the cockpit that is mostly black/dark gray, including the pilots seats and belts.
Can't see much of them in the pictures.

So far I completed the fuselage. I made two mistakes but managed to undo the damage. part#6, the skin that is to be glued under the cockpits is about 2mm longer than the cockpit frame. I'll leave the nose part unglued until after I install the canopies, and than it'll be easier to fix this problem.
